Scripps Institution of Oceanography is the first-ranked, global institution for ocean, Earth, and atmospheric research and education and the Earth Sciences Department of UC San Diego. Scripps scientists have been exploring the globe for over a century to understand and protect the planet.


UC San Diego Scripps Institution of Oceanography works with companies on a diverse range of projects, including research collaboration, talent recruitment, sponsorship, communications, and innovation. As a complement, companies can join Scripps Corporate Alliance for annual coordination of these projects and custom liaison services to the Scripps community and assets.

Vanessa Scott leads industry and innovation initiatives at Scripps Institution of Oceanography to connect the science and applied research to companies and assist the development and launch of ocean and climate focused startups.  Her background is in business development and industry outreach in the biotech industry with over seventeen years of experience cultivating strong industry partnerships and facilitating opportunities for collaboration and growth. She also has extensive experience working in non-profit fundraising and marine conservation organizations. Vanessa completed a Masters in Advanced Studies in Marine Biodiversity and Conservation from Scripps Institution of Oceanography where she developed a business and marketing plan for Smartfin, an ocean-focused startup, to support the launch from lab to market.

Canon Purdy facilitates the connection between science and applied research to companies as the Industry Relations and Innovation Analyst. She earned a Masters of Advanced Studies from Scripps Institution of Oceanography and her research explored the relationship between media and marine mammals in Southern California. As a California Sea Grant Fellow, she worked in the Department of Fish and Wildlife's Aquaculture Program, supporting aquaculture development in state and federal waters. She co-founded the networking group Women in Aquaculture to better connect the industry with research, government, and international partners. Most recently, she worked for the Waitt Institute as a Communications Manager, leading outreach and awareness in Bermuda and the Federated States of Micronesia to support program goals of developing Blue Economy initiatives while creating Marine Protected Area networks.
